CBDT prescribes rules to calculate income from life insurance where premium exceeds Rs 5 lakh
Income Tax department on Wednesday prescribed a mechanism for calculating income proceeds from life insurance policies where aggregate annual premium exceeds Rs 5 lakh. The Central Board of Direct Taxes (CBDT) has notified the Income Tax Amendment (Sixteenth Amendment), Rules, 2023, prescribing rule 11UACA for calculating income with respect to the sum received upon maturity of life insurance policies wherein the amount of premiums exceed Rs 5 lakh and such policy/policies are issued on or after April 1, 2023. According to the change, for policies issued on or after April 1, 2023, the tax exemption on maturity benefits under Section 10(10D) will only be applicable if the aggregate premium paid by an individual is up to Rs 5 lakh a year. For premiums beyond this limit, the proceeds will be added to the income and taxed at applicable rates. The change in tax provision with regard to life insurance policies, except ULIP, was announced in the Union Budget 2023-24.

PM Vishwakarma initiative will celebrate our traditional artisans, crafts people: Modi
Union Cabinet approving the 'PM Vishwakarma' scheme,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Wednesday said the initiative will celebrate traditional artisans and crafts people, both from rural and urban India. The Union Cabinet on Wednesday approved the 'PM Vishwakarma' scheme with a financial outlay of Rs 13,000 crore for a period of five years that will benefit about 30 lakh families of traditional artisans and craftsmen, including weavers, goldsmiths, blacksmiths, laundry workers and barbers.

Windall tax on crude oil increased to ₹7,100 per tonne
New Delhi: The union ministry of finance has increased the windfall tax on sale of locally produced crude oil to ₹7,100 per tonne. For the past two weeks, the windfall tax on domestically produced crude oil was ₹4,250 per tonne. The increase would come into effect from 15 August.

Centre amends requirements for HVDC transmission system bids
New Delhi: The union ministry of power has made changes to the technical requirements for bidding of high voltage direct current (HVDC) transmission systems through tariff based competitive bidding (TBCB) route. Through the amendment, government has raise the requisite period of experience in the infrastructure to 10 years from 5 years. The minimum individual project experience would be ₹100 crore.

Terms of deal that ended B.C. port strike revealed
port dispute, including a commitment by employers to train workers to perform maintenance on new equipment.Contracting out of maintenance work to third parties had been one of the most contentious issues during the months-long dispute between the International Longshore and Warehouse Union Canada and the BC Maritime Employers Association.The four-year agreement also contains several terms about workers’ compensation.They include increases in the “Modernization and Mechanization retirement lump sum,” bringing that payout to $96,250 in 2026 for eligible retirees, over and above normal pension entitlements.The union representing about 7,400 workers said last Friday its members voted almost 75 per cent in favour of ratifying the new deal, ending a dispute that included a 13-day strike and halted movement of cargo worth billions.The deal features general wage increases of five per cent annually for the next two years, and four per cent for the two years after that.Those raises will boost hourly wages to a base rate of $57.51 by 2026.The new terms commit employers to “provide appropriate training to Journeyman Tradesperson … on how to perform regular maintenance work (within) the scope of their trade on new equipment and existing equipment.”

Lok Sabha passes Digital Personal Data Protection Bill, 2023
Lok Sabha on Monday passed the Digital Personal Data Protection Bill, 2023 which lays down the obligations of entities handling and processing data as well as the rights of individuals. The bill proposes a maximum penalty of Rs 250 crore and minimum of Rs 50 crore on entities violating the norms. The norms will apply to personal data collected within India from data principals online, and personal data collected offline, but subsequently digitised. It will also apply to such processing outside India if it is for offering goods or services to individuals in India. Union Communications, Electronics and Information Technology Minister Ashwini Vaishnaw had tabled the bill in the lower house on August 3. Opposition had demanded that it should be sent to the standing committee for scrutiny. While moving the bill, Vaishnaw had rejected suggestions that it was a money bill saying it was a «normal bill». The bill provides for the processing of digital personal data in a manner “that recognises both the right of individuals to protect their personal data and the need to process such personal data for lawful purposes”.
